This Clinical Daily Regular Cleanse makes several claims including regular BMs, less bloating, daily detox, etc. that have not been evaluated by the FDA. But I can say that I evaluated the claim of regular BMs and found it to be true. I started at one capsule/day (the full dose is three capsules a day per the bottle) and one capsule was plenty to get the job done for me, so I started to give this product 5 stars. But...while some of the ingredients are standard (psyllium, for example, is in many fiber products), some are a little out there (like bentonite clay, which is an ingredient in kitty litter). And 2250 mg/capsule of their "proprietary blend" would equal 2.25 grams of fiber per capsule; if you take three, that's only 6.75 grams of fiber, less fiber than in a bowl of raisin bran. Lastly, if you are vegan, or have food allergies, the capsule (which is rather large, see photo) is made of bovine gelatin and the blend contains tree nuts PLUS all seven of the major allergens are present in their manufacturing and processing facility. Worked for me, might or might not be a good choice for you, depending on which of the product's claims you are interested in and your dietary needs.
